摘要:The practice of evaluation is gaining importance across governments in Africa.
Country-driven evaluation should enhance the government’s capacity for
accountability, knowledge management, performance, as well as improved
decision making. Countries that have implemented national evaluation systems
include Benin, Uganda, and South Africa. Emerging research tends to focus on
methodologies or sector-specific aspects of evaluation. This article examines the
specific challenge of public procurement for conducting evaluations as
knowledge-based services. The article is based on a baseline study. The
methodology for the study involved a literature review; in-depth interviews; focus
groups with government officials, evaluation suppliers, trainers, and nongovernmental
organisations (NGOs); a root-cause analysis workshop; and an
online survey with both clients and suppliers. The findings are that the quality of
government procurement and supply chain management is a major factor that
affects the supply of evaluators. The article concludes by offering
recommendations to enhance the process of public procurement.
